[0059] An exemplary embodiment of a density monitor 22 is shown in the drawing. The density monitor 22 is designed for monitoring the gas density in the measurement volume. The density monitor 22 is provided with an overall housing 50 which is divided into a measurement area housing part 52 and a cable connection housing part 54 .
[0060] The measuring range housing part 52 contains a measuring device 56 with a detection device 26 for converting a variable that varies with the gas density into an electrical signal, as well as a first plug-in element 58 of a plug-in part 62 .
[0061] The cable connection housing part 54 contains a cable connection region 61 and a second plug element 60 of a plug part 62 .
